    coruscation
    [kôrəˈskāSHən]
    definition
    1. noun form of coruscate
    cor·us·cate
    [ˈkôrəˌskāt]
    verb
    literary
    coruscate (verb) · coruscates (third person present) · coruscated (past tense) · coruscated (past participle) · coruscating (present participle)
    1. (of light) flash or sparkle:
      "the light was coruscating from the walls"
    Origin
    early 18th century: from Latin coruscat- ‘glittered’, from the verb coruscare.
